This daily excavation checklist helps crews inspect trenches and excavations before work begins. Verify soil classification, depth and width, protective systems (trench boxes, shoring or sloping), barricades and signage, spoil placement, and pre-job training. Confirm utilities are located and supported, overhead lines noted, and underground installations protected. Check wet conditions and dewatering controls, conduct post-rain inspections, and assess hazardous atmospheres with testing and ventilation as needed. Ensure safe entry and exit with secured ladders or ramps within 25 feet, and document hazards, corrective actions, and sign-off to meet regulatory requirements for excavation safety.
